Protect your skin and allow it to rest. Remember that your skin is the largest organ of your body: it is that part of the body that is most exposed to the elements, including harmful radiation from the sun. To combat this, stay away from sunlight during the hours of 10am to 3pm and wear sunscreen when going outdoors.
With all that stress, you should allow your skin (and in essence, your entire body) the time it needs to recover and rebuild damaged cells in preparation for the following day. Avoid smoking and drinking. Next to harmful UV rays, cigarettes and alcohol are the worst culprits of stealing your skin’s healthy youthful look. They add toxins to a body and shows not only on your skin but in the rest of your body as well.

Not having a bowel movement every day doesn’t necessarily mean you’re constipated. Constipation can be defined as having a bowel movement fewer than three times per week and the stools are typically hard, dry, small in size, and difficult to eliminate. Sometimes it is painful to have a bowel movement and straining, bloating, and the sensation of a full bowel may be experienced.

Alcohol and drug treatment has changed a lot over the years. The first forms of alcohol and drug treatment were quite brutal; in the dark ages it was thought that addictions were caused by demonic possession, which had many different prescribed ‘cures’ ranging from blood letting to being burned at the stake. In the 19th and early 20th century, alcohol and drug treatment had improved but little; addictions were then considered forms of insanity and the treatments of choice involved straight jackets, padded rooms, and electric shocks.

Poison ivy treatments differ depending on what area of the body was exposed and to what degree. For a milder exposure, poison ivy treatment may just be a cold shower and over the counter calamine lotion or topical steroid cream. A more severe exposure may need more extensive poison ivy treatments, such as oral steroids to get the rash under control.

The common phrases, “toxic black mold†or “toxic mold†refer to a type of mold known in the science community as “Stachybotry chartarum.â€Â
There are many molds that have a black color, and not all of them produce toxins all of the time. The toxic type of mold has the Stachybotrys strain that can produce poisons that are known as “mycotoxins.†The temperature and humidity must be right for mycotoxins to flourish. These mycotoxins are dependent on oxygen.
